Hello to all leprechauns, unicorns and other bizarre creatures! Happy St. Patrick’s Day! The legend tells that Patrick comes from a wealthy family and subsequently discovered the path to Christianity. He is considered as a Baptist of Ireland and mortal enemy of the snakes on the island, which he banished forever from the green land.
To explain the meaning of the Holy Trinity to the pagans, he used a three-leaf shamrock, whose color has subsequently become a national symbol of Ireland. Besides as Saint Patrick, among the Irish he is also known as Paddy. On this occasion, I decided to diversify the unpleasant Monday with a brief review of the Irish whiskey „Paddy“.
„Paddy“ is a triple distilled blended Irish Whiskey, without presence of peat and matured in oak barrels for up to 7 years. The color is gold/ straw. I caught the expressive aroma of citrus and caramel. The taste is sweet, malty but it seemed to me too alcoholic. The aftertaste is medium long, buttered, with slightly pronounced sweetness that fades fairly quickly.
The price for 0.700 is around 25-28 lv. Assessment: 3,5 / 6.
